R. Mostowicz is a scholar working on Inorganic Chemistry, Materials Chemistry and Industrial and Manufacturing Engineering. According to data from OpenAlex, R. Mostowicz has authored 17 papers receiving a total of 390 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Inorganic Chemistry, 11 papers in Materials Chemistry and 7 papers in Industrial and Manufacturing Engineering. Recurrent topics in R. Mostowicz's work include Zeolite Catalysis and Synthesis (16 papers), Chemical Synthesis and Characterization (7 papers) and Mesoporous Materials and Catalysis (6 papers). R. Mostowicz is often cited by papers focused on Zeolite Catalysis and Synthesis (16 papers), Chemical Synthesis and Characterization (7 papers) and Mesoporous Materials and Catalysis (6 papers). R. Mostowicz collaborates with scholars based in Italy, Poland and Belgium. R. Mostowicz's co-authors include L. B. Sand, F. Crea, J.B. Nagy, Harry Pfeifer, R. Aiello, F. Testa, Michael Hunger, Bodo Zibrowius, Jürgen Caro and Martin Bülow and has published in prestigious journals such as Microporous and Mesoporous Materials, Zeolites and Zeitschrift für Physikalische Chemie.

All Works

17 of 17 papers shown
1.
Aiello, R., F. Crea, F. Testa, et al.. (1999). The influence of alkali cations on the synthesis of ZSM-5 in fluoride medium. Microporous and Mesoporous Materials. 28(2). 241–259. 41 indexed citations
2.
Mostowicz, R., F. Testa, F. Crea, et al.. (1997). Synthesis of zeolite beta in presence of fluorides: Influence of alkali cations. Zeolites. 18(5-6). 308–324. 35 indexed citations
4.
Fonseca, A., et al.. (1995). The effect of thermal treatment and of grinding on silicalite-1 synthesized in the presence of fluoride ions. Zeolites. 15(3). 259–263. 10 indexed citations
5.
Mostowicz, R., et al.. (1993). Crystallization of silicalite-1 in the presence of fluoride ions. Zeolites. 13(8). 678–684. 21 indexed citations
6.
Derewinski, Miroslaw A., Stanisław Dźwigaj, J. Haber, R. Mostowicz, & Bogdan Sulikowski. (1992). ChemInform Abstract: Isomorphous Substitution in Zeolites: Acidic and Catalytic Properties of (B)‐, (B,Al)‐ and (Al)‐ZSM‐5.. ChemInform. 23(7). 1 indexed citations
7.
Crea, F., R. Mostowicz, F. Testa, et al.. (1992). Thermal analysis of fluorine containing gels and precursors of high silica zeolites. Journal of thermal analysis. 38(4). 693–700. 2 indexed citations
8.
Tavolaro, Adalgisa, et al.. (1992). Formation of MFI crystalline zeosilites from fluoride-containing silicate gels. Zeolites. 12(6). 756–761. 23 indexed citations
10.
Testa, F., F. Crea, A. Nastro, et al.. (1991). Formation of high-silica zeolites from xM2O-yTAABr-Al2O3-zSiO2-3000 H2O gels (M = Li or K and TAA = tetramethyl, tetraethyl, and tetrabutyl). Zeolites. 11(6). 633–638. 14 indexed citations
11.
Derewinski, Miroslaw A., Stanisław Dźwigaj, J. Haber, R. Mostowicz, & Bogdan Sulikowski. (1991). Isomorphous Substitution in Zeolites: Acidic and Catalytic Properties of [B]-, [B, Al]- and [Al]-ZSM-5. Zeitschrift für Physikalische Chemie. 171(1). 53–73. 12 indexed citations
12.
Crea, F., G. Giordano, R. Mostowicz, & A. Nastro. (1990). Thermal behaviour of the tpa IONS in ZSM-5 zeolite: II. Effect of crystal size and grinding of silicalite-1. Journal of thermal analysis. 36(6). 2229–2233. 3 indexed citations
13.
Mostowicz, R., et al.. (1989). ChemInform Abstract: Morphology of Zeolites, Primarily Pentasils, and Its Significance for Catalysis. ChemInform. 20(17). 2 indexed citations
14.
Hunger, Michael, Jörg Kärger, Harry Pfeifer, et al.. (1987). Investigation of internal silanol groups as structural defects in ZSM-5-type zeolites. Journal of the Chemical Society Faraday Transactions 1 Physical Chemistry in Condensed Phases. 83(11). 3459–3459. 95 indexed citations
15.
Pfeifer, Harry, et al.. (1987). Controlled coke deposition on zeolite ZSM5 and its influence on molecular transport. Applied Catalysis. 29(1). 21–30. 35 indexed citations
16.
Mostowicz, R. & L. B. Sand. (1983). Morphological study of ZSM—5 grown in the 12na2O/4.5(tpa)2O system. Zeolites. 3(3). 219–225. 29 indexed citations
17.
Mostowicz, R. & L. B. Sand. (1982). Crystallization of ZSM-5 with relatively high (Me2/n)2O/(TPA)2O reactant ratios. Zeolites. 2(2). 143–146. 44 indexed citations
